The Importance of Choosing Healthy Bread

Bread is one of the most commonly consumed foods in our daily diet. It is considered a staple food, especially when it comes to sandwiches. However, not all breads are created equal. Some contain refined flour and added sugars which can contribute to health problems like obesity and diabetes.

Choosing healthy bread options at Subway can help individuals maintain a balanced diet and reduce their risk of developing chronic diseases. Healthy bread options are typically made from whole grains that provide essential nutrients and fiber for our bodies.

Tips for Making Your Subway Sandwich Even Healthier

While choosing one of the healthier bread options is an essential step towards making your Subway sandwich more nutritious, there are other ways to boost its health profile.

1. Load Up on Veggies
One of the best things about Subway is their wide selection of fresh vegetables. Take advantage of this by piling on as many veggies as you can. Not only do they add flavor and texture to your sandwich, but they are also low in calories and packed with nutrients.

2. Choose Lean Proteins
Subway offers a variety of protein options such as chicken, turkey breast, and grilled steak. Opt for these lean proteins instead of high-fat options like bacon or processed deli meats.

3. Skip the Mayo
Mayonnaise is high in calories and contains unhealthy fats. Instead, opt for healthier condiments like mustard or avocado spread for some healthy fats.

4. Be Aware of Portion Sizes
While six inches may seem like the standard size for a sandwich at Subway, keep in mind that you can always choose to get a smaller portion and load up on extra veggies to make it more filling. Also, try to resist the temptation of adding extras like chips or cookies to your order.
